2. CONCEPT AND TYPES OF INFORMATION: DOCUMENTED AND UNDOCUMENTED INFORMATION

There are different approaches to understanding information.

In terms of philosophy Get in touch - this is a kind of diversity that the reflecting subject creates about the reflected; message, awareness of the state of affairs, information about something transmitted by people.

Information types:

1) elementary - at the atomic level;

2) biological - created by living beings;

3) social - the area of ​​human relations;

4) technical-cybernetic - a derivative created as a result of the activity of machines and partially regulated by law.

From a legal point of view Get in touch - information about the surrounding world, the processes occurring in it and a message about the state of affairs or the state of something.

The object of legal regulation can only be the information that a person extracts from the environment and displays in his mind.

The following legal properties of information are distinguished.

1. Physical inalienability, since the alienation of information is replaced by the transfer of rights to use it.

2. Isolation - for inclusion in circulation, information is used in the form of symbols and signs, and thus it is isolated and exists separately from the manufacturer.

3. The duality of information and media, i.e. understanding information as a thing on a material medium.

4. Prevalence - replication.

5. Organizational form of information - document. Information can be classified according to various criteria.

1. According to the form of expression - documented. This is a special organizational form of information expression based on the dual unity of information (information) and a material carrier on which it is reflected in the form of symbols, signs, letters, waves or other display methods.

The Federal Law of December 29, 1994 No. 78-FZ "On Librarianship" defines a document as a material object with information recorded on it in the form of text, sound recording or image, intended for transmission in time and space for storage and public use.

In the Federal Law of February 20, 1 No. 995-FZ "On Information, Informatization and Information Protection", a document means information recorded on a material carrier with details that allow it to be identified.

2. According to the source of creation:

a) undocumented - remains outside the legal regulation;

b) legal - is created as a result of law-making activities, law enforcement and law enforcement activities:

▪ regulatory legal information;

▪ non-regulatory legal information;

c) non-legal - is not created as a result of legal activity, but is circulated in society in accordance with the prescriptions of legal norms.

3. According to the degree of access, open information (all non-legal; about elections and referendums; from official documents) and limited information (state secret; official secret; professional secret; personal secret; commercial secret; personal data; know-how).

4. By circle of persons, mass information (printed, audio messages, audiovisual and other messages and materials intended for an unlimited circle of people) and individual information (information is an object of civil rights).

The existence of an entropy rule for quantum entanglement has been proven 09.05.2024

Quantum mechanics continues to amaze us with its mysterious phenomena and unexpected discoveries. Recently, Bartosz Regula from the RIKEN Center for Quantum Computing and Ludovico Lamy from the University of Amsterdam presented a new discovery that concerns quantum entanglement and its relation to entropy. Quantum entanglement plays an important role in modern quantum information science and technology. However, the complexity of its structure makes understanding and managing it challenging. Regulus and Lamy's discovery shows that quantum entanglement follows an entropy rule similar to that for classical systems. This discovery opens new perspectives in the field of quantum information science and technology, deepening our understanding of quantum entanglement and its connection to thermodynamics. The results of the study indicate the possibility of reversibility of entanglement transformations, which could greatly simplify their use in various quantum technologies. Opening a new rule ... >>

Nanohousing for sun-loving bacteria 10.03.2022

Researchers at the University of Cambridge in the UK have 3D printed a grid of high-rise "nano-housing" in which sun-loving bacteria can grow rapidly. With these "houses," scientists have been able to extract more of the energy generated from photosynthesis from bacteria, which can be used to power small electronics - more than with traditional renewable bioenergy production methods.

Cyanobacteria are large bacteria capable of photosynthesis. For several years, researchers have been trying to "reconfigure" the mechanisms of photosynthesis in cyanobacteria in order to extract energy from them. To grow, cyanobacteria need a lot of sunlight - for this they are well suited, for example, the surface of a lake in summer. And in order to extract the energy they produce from photosynthesis, bacteria must be attached to electrodes.

A team from Cambridge has 3D printed special electrodes from metal oxide nanoparticles - highly branched, densely packed columnar structures, similar to a tiny city. Scientists have developed a printing method that allows you to control the different lengths of the bars.

The new method increased the amount of extracted energy by an order of magnitude compared to other methods of producing bioenergy from photosynthesis.

"Cyanobacteria are versatile chemical factories. Our approach allows us to use their energy conversion pathways at an early stage, which helps us understand how they perform energy conversion so that we can use their natural pathways for renewable fuels or chemical production," the authors note. work.
